The Minister for Justice and Equality is the Contracting Authority for public procurement competition and invites expressions of interest, under the Restricted Procedure, from suitably qualified service providers for the provision of a Fleet Management Consultant to the Irish Prison Service (IPS). In summary, the Contracting Authority requires a Fleet Management Consultant to conduct an Audit of the IPS fleet, develop fleet policies, ensure fleet compliance and implement a fleet management system into the IPS. The key features and the outline of the Services sought are set out in Part 2 of this Pre-Qualification Questionnaire (โPQQโ).
